18 May: Eric Name Day

Today is the name day for people called Eric. Eric/Erik is an old Norse name which means "eternal ruler, ever powerful". 10 famous Erics:

  1. Erik the Red: Norse explorer, who according to medieval and Icelandic sagas founded the first settlement in Greenland. He most likely earned the epithet "the Red" due to the colour of his hair and beard.
  2. Eric Cantona: French footballer. He played for Manchester United, and is known for turning up his collar. After retiring from Football he became an actor and producer.
  3. Eric Clapton: English guitarist, vocalist, and songwriter. He is the only person to be inducted to the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ame three times: once as a solo artist and also as a member of the Yardbirds and of Cream.
  4. Eric Liddell: Scottish athlete and missionary. He competed in the 1924 Paris Olympics, but had to withdraw from his best event, the 100 metres, because one of the heats was held on a Sunday, because, as a devout Christian, that was a day of rest. His story is told in the 1981 film, Chariots of Fire.
  5. Eric Morecambe: English comedian, partner of Ernie Wise.
  6. Eric Idle: English comedian, actor, singer and comedic composer, a member of the Monty Python Team and the spoof band, The Rutles.
  7. Eric Sykes: English radio, television and film writer, actor and director who wrote for, and performed with, comedy greats such as Tony Hancock and the Goons.
  8. Eric Stoltz: American actor, director and producer whose film roles include The Mask and Pulp Fiction. He was almost Marty McFly in Back to the Future as well, when it was thought Michael J Fox, the first choice, was tied up filming a TV series. They started filming with Stoltz but after about a month, Fox's filming schedule changed and Stoltz was replaced by Fox. In the TV series Fringe, in one episode set in a parallel universe, cinema hoardings are seen which read "Back to the Future starring Eric Stoltz".
  9. Eric Cartman: one of the four main characters in the TV series South Park
  10. Eric Northman: love interest of Sookie Stackhouse in the Southern Vampire Mysteries novels and the TV series True Blood. He is a vampire, slightly over one thousand years old.
